HIGH COURT ISSUES NOTIES TO CHIEF SECRETARY, OTHERS ON INSTALLATION OF STONE CRUSHER

September 06, 2021 08:34 PM

 Shimla (Vijyender Sharma)

The High Court of Himachal Pradesh  today issued notices to the Chief Secretary to the Government of H.P., Chairman, H.P. State Pollution Control Board, Deputy Commissioner, Hamirpur, Sub Divisional Magistrate, Nadaun and Secretary, Gram Panchayat, Jol Sapper,  in a matter related to  installation of   Stone Crusher in Gram Panchayat Jol Sapper in District Hamirpur, H.P. alleged to be adversely affecting the environment and ecology of the area.

Division Bench comprising the Acting Chief Justice Ravi Malimath and Justice Jyotsna Rewal Dua passed these orders on a petition taken up suo moto by the Court as Public Interest Litigation on a letter addressed to the Chief Justice by one Dalip Singh.  The petitioner has alleged  that one Shri Ramesh Kumar applied for No-Objection Certificate from the Gram Panchayat Jol Sapper, for the purpose of setting up of a Stone Crusher  and the Panchayat issued the same, without considering its  adverse impact on the area. He has alleged that alongwith the crusher, there is a water lifting project installed in the Kunah Khad, which is on the verge of closure  as the water level is constantly going down.

He has also alleged that due to the stone crusher even the green fodder of the cattle is getting polluted and dust is settling on the trees and the entire environment is getting polluted. He has alleged that the heavily loaded tippers are damaging the link roads connecting the National Highway, which have been constructed under the Pradhan Mantri Gramin Sadak Yojana.

He has  further alleged that the mining in the ravine is being carried out to a depth of 30-40 feet and Mining Rules are being violated, but the mining officials have never visited the spot despite such glaring violations. He has alleged that  on account of indiscriminate mining, water level of the hand pumps are also decreasing considerably and  in addition to this, the health of the humans and animals are also being adversely affected. 

It is alleged that ailments like asthama are on the rise in the area, which is aggravating the already alarming situation created on account of the corona pandemic. He has alleged that a house near the ravine has been badly damaged due to deeply dug pits in the ravine and the entire village is in danger.  He has prayed for shutting down the  stone crusher immediately, in view of the damage being caused by the same.
